This member of Class WaveLinkTerminal is supported on iOS, Windows Mobile, Windows CE, Palm, and DOS.
The TerminalType Method returns a string specifying the type of device currently connected.
Syntax
public String TerminalType()
Returns
Current device type
Remarks
To improve network efficiency, the terminal settings within the WaveLinkTerminal object are only set when the object is first created. To return the most current information you must first use the ReadTerminalInfo Method, which updates the WaveLinkTerminal object with the latest device settings, before making a call to any other methods.
The possible device types are:
LRT
PALM_PILOT
PDT
PDT61XX
PDT68XX
PERCON_FALCON
VRC_PRC
WS10XX
